In Theodora’s projects, she has created films that are used as backgrounds to help teachers “travel” to imaginary and immersive environments, in combination with storytelling, drama pedagogy, and set design. These environments include rainbow clouds, space, small objects, the sea, the forest, and the garden. These films can be part of the scenography in an interactive classroom, theater, library, or museum exhibition, and they align with the storytelling and transformations occurring in both the narrative and set design. Examples of the videos follow, but additional videos have been created for each story and set design. The purpose is to inspire and provide a visual tool for educators, librarians, museum educators, and theater professionals to integrate these topics into their practices.
